|
|
ru.perl- RU.PERL ---------------------------------------------------------------------- From : Protasovitski Andrei 2:5020/400 06 Dec 2002 11:11:09 To : Sergey Nepsha Subject : Re: что значит сие? -------------------------------------------------------------------------------- Доброго здоровья! "Sergey Nepsha" <Sergey.Nepsha@f82.n5083.z2.fidonet.org> сообщил/сообщила в новостях следующее: news:3471773394@f82.n5083.z2.fidonet.ftn... > вот строка кода программы: > my $col_name = (defined($show_thumbnail) ? "thumbnail" : "$image"); > > что означают эти ? и : ^ ^ > > -- > XMMS: Bosson_-_I_Believe Дословно: Локальной переменной $col_name присвоить значение "thumbnail", если определена переменная $show_thumbnail; в противном случае, ей присвоить значение "$image". Можно записать так: my $col_name = defined($show_thumbnail) ? "thumbnail" : $image; -- Andrei. Отправлено через сервер Форумы@mail.ru - http://talk.mail.ru --- ifmail v.2.15dev5 * Origin: Talk.Mail.Ru (2:5020/400) Вернуться к списку тем, сортированных по: возрастание даты уменьшение даты тема автор
Архивное /ru.perl/648829034703.html, оценка из 5, голосов 10
|